Introduction

If you are having problems with a specific pest in your home, this is where you want to look first. Identification is a very important part of any IPM program, in homes or schools.

How do you begin to use Integrated Pest Management in your home? We suggest that you begin with exclusion and then move on to the other methods of IPM. Each plays an intimate role in aiding in the elimination and prevention of pests.

Exclusion

  • Exclusion refers to blocking entry points for pests such as caulking around windows, making sure door sweeps are tightly in place and patching holes.
